As of Aug 2025, the median cost of dog boarding in Saint Paul Park is $45 per night, including service fees. Boarding your dog for one week typically costs $315. Sitters on Rover set their own rates based on their qualifications, your dog's needs, and their space's amenities. As a result, most Saint Paul Park dog boarding rates can be found as low as $42 to as high as $55 per night.
As of Aug 2025, 2,094 sitters provided dog boarding in Saint Paul Park.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ect sitter near you. As a reminder, dog boarding sitters jo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your dog’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ple sitters about your booking. Typically, 91% of Saint Paul Park dog boarding sitters respond in under an hour.
Sitters who provide dog boarding in Saint Paul Park have an average of 17 years of experience. Dog boarding sitters with repeat customers have an average of 11 repeat clients. Experience can vary from sitter to s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when you compare sitters in Saint Paul Park.
